Files & datasheets

Upload files to qr3 and link them to a code — perfect for product datasheets, manuals or certificates.

Attach files to a code

  1. Open the code’s detail page in the dashboard.
  2. In the Files section, upload one or more files (PDF, images, …).
  3. Choose the visibility when uploading:
    • Public (pre-selected in the dashboard) — served at a stable link and shown on the code’s landing page.
    • Private — uncheck Public to store the file without serving it publicly.

One code, several datasheets

A code can hold multiple files. To let a single scan reach all of them, enable landing page mode: the scan opens a qr3-hosted page listing every public file of that code.

When a scan should open one specific document — instead of the landing page with its file list — use the file’s public link as the QR code’s target URL.

  1. Open the code’s detail page.
  2. In the Files section, click Copy public link on the file you want.
  3. Paste the address as a QR code’s target URL.

The link needs no sign-in and opens the file directly in the browser — so a PDF shows in the preview instead of downloading. The button only appears for files whose visibility is Public; private files get no public address.

Replacing the file leaves this link unchanged (see below). If more documents may follow later, the landing page is the better target — it always lists the current files.

Update a datasheet without reprinting

Use Replace on a file to swap its contents while keeping the same download address. The printed QR code keeps working: the link stays identical, only the file behind it changes. Upload the new version, and scans serve the updated datasheet.

Take a file down

Use Delete to withdraw a file: it disappears from the file list and from the landing page, and its public link stops serving it.
